The upgrade and enclosure of the Warringah Freeway also provides a unique opportunity to deliver a better and more sustainable public transport system for Sydney.
The Connecting Sydney design details light rail routes for the Lower North Shore and proposes an innovative extension of the rail network to the Northern Beaches.
The light rail network will connect City on a Hill with North Sydney, Neutral Bay, St Leonards and Lane Cove, and can be extended to Mosman, Crows Nest, Chatswood and the Sydney CBD.
The North Shore light rail will be fully integrated with the existing transport system and can achieve the high passenger utilisation required to justify delivery without requiring public subsidy.
